"Join the Army at Once & Help to Stop an Air Raid" Vintage British WWI Poster
Located in Colorado Springs, CO
"Join the Army at Once & Help to Stop an Air Raid" Vintage British WWI Poster, 1915
This vintage British recruitment poster, published in 1915, calls on men to join the Army. In full, the text reads, “It is far better to face the bullets than to be killed at home by a bomb / Join the Army at once & help stop an air raid / God save the king.” On the poster, a silhouette of London lies beneath a spotlighted German Zeppelin looming above. This recruitment poster is displayed in a custom-built archival frame.
WWI was the first time British civilians were in the direct line of fire in the modern era, creating the idea of the "homefront.’" Traditionally concerned with its coastal borders, Britain was highly unprepared for a sudden and prolonged German air raid. Throughout 1915 and 1916, successive German Zeppelin attacks ravaged several cities, but most notably London. These attacks continued until 1918, but newer aircrafts were used. The Germans hoped to enrage the British people so that they would demand their government made peace. However, their plan backfired when the United Kingdom cried for German defeat...
